Management Meeting Minutes — Licensing Dispute

Attendees: R. Kellan, M. Osweth, D. Prine.

Quick recap for branch managers: Varnholt Media is still contesting our use of the Skylace rendering toolkit, claiming our licence lapsed in Q2. Legal thinks their reading is shaky, but we've paused new Skylace deployments to be safe. Osweth is drafting a settlement range; Prine will brief branches individually. Expect a decision within three weeks — don't discuss externally. The confidential note on our business plans sits just below these minutes.

board note of bawep-tajef: Queniusek Systems plans to raise the Quenvan list price by 53.1 percent in March. The pricing group signed off on a budget of $176.4 million for Project Drueth. The renewal with Casionix Partners closes at $142.5 million a year, 8.3 percent below the last contract. Project Fraax slips by six weeks because of the tooling delay.

Subject: Handover — Relaywire compression settings

Hi Dorin,

Before my leave: we left permessage-deflate enabled only for payloads over 2KB, since CPU cost on the gateway outweighed bandwidth savings below that. Watch the broker's memory during peak; window bits are capped at 12. Session stats land in the telemetry database, reachable with the string below.

replica DSN, yahog-kawig: redis://istox_svc:um@db-8a67.halixforge.test:5432/frawyn

Subject: Scheduled rotation — Wavecrest preview service key

As part of our quarterly credential hygiene cycle, we have rotated the API key used by the Wavecrest audio waveform preview service. The previous key will be revoked after a 72-hour overlap window. Please confirm that the audit log reflects no usage of the old credential after revocation, and that scopes remain limited to read-only preview generation. The replacement key is provided below.

service key, tadup-tahog: zpat7_wB1tnEL

Bulk edits in the Ashgrove admin table are capped to protect the Pellmont write path. Selections beyond the row limit are chunked automatically, and each chunk runs inside its own transaction, so a mid-batch failure rolls back only that chunk. Do not raise these values without a load test; the current caps are below.

tuning table, hafog-bahaf:
QUOTAS = {
    "praion": 144,
    "briax": 906,
    "silwyn": 451,
}